I have an 89 5.0 that has developed an issue with bucking, lugging what ever you want to call it (I assume this is pre-ignition) at low rpms, but only when the car is warm, and pretty much only when it is warm outside. On longer trips this pretty much rules out 5th gear, in Idaho I just drive 85 to 90 mph and it mostly goes away. To date I've replace the plugs, plug wires, distributor cap, rotor button, and fuel injectors. I assume this is being caused do to running too lean, and am thinking it may be the mass airflow sensor, but the problem does not go away when I unplug it. The O2 sensors have about 80,000 miles on them, and the car has no cats (its been this way for years the bucking problem has only started in the last two months), I did have a K&N oiled filter on the car. Any recommendations? FYI car has 340,000 miles but only 60,000 on new motor, and I am original owner.

